Abstract

The utility model relates to a concrete retaining wall of a waterfront revetment, which is formed by supporting templates and placing concrete. The adopted templates are steel templates which can be removed after use. The retaining wall comprises a retaining wall main body and a retaining base, the retaining wall main body and the retaining wall base are anchored through a plurality of reinforced steel bars, a plurality of horizontally extending tie reinforced steel bars are arranged at the upper part and the lower part of the concrete structure between the wall back and the wall surface, and adjacent steel templates are connected and fixed through connecting reinforced steel bars. In the concrete retaining wall, the steel templates are used for replacing wood templates and can be recycled, the resource is saved, the adjustment of perpendicularity, evenness and radian can be carried out conveniently, and the construction efficiency is improved. Zoological concrete is used for placing, not only can the action of a high-strength reinforcing dam be exerted, but also the actions of purifying water quality and protecting the ecological system are exerted due to porosity and good air and water permeability. With the arrangement of tie reinforced steel bars and a steel wire mesh, the strength of the retaining wall is greatly enhanced.

The specific embodiment
As shown in Figure 1, the utility model provides the concrete guard wall of a kind of shore water barge bank, adopts the formwork fluid concrete to process, the steel form 1 that the template that is adopted is removed for the enough backs of ability.Serve as reasons down supreme step pouring, sclerosis of said concrete guard wall forms, and its structure comprises the basic two parts of barricade body and barricade.Said steel form can adopt turnbuckle and typing reinforcing bar drag hook that verticality, planeness and the radian of template are adjusted when mounted; Can remove and recycle with the said steel form in back; Than adopting wooden form; Adjust conveniently, efficiency of construction is greatly improved, and has also avoided the disposable waste of material simultaneously.
Said barricade basis also is a concrete structure; Between said barricade body and the barricade basis through many reinforcing bar anchorings; When building the barricade basis; The preferred reinforcing bar leftover bits and pieces (promptly aforesaid " many reinforcing bars ") that adopts is as earth anchor, to guarantee the outside extension of bottom template when the concreting, also saved material.In practical operation, can use the wood chip piece to finely tune.
The upper and lower reinforcing bar that sockets that is provided with many horizontal directions extensions in the wall back of the body of said barricade body and the concrete structure between the metope; Socket reach outside the two ends of reinforcing bar with the said wall back of the body and the corresponding steel form of metope outside; And steel form outer a plurality of said end that sockets reinforcing bar in the same side is fixed together, and sockets reinforcing bar and plays the effect of reinforcing steel form, after the hardening of concrete; The said reinforcing bar that sockets is cemented in the concrete structure, can effectively improve the intensity of said concrete guard wall.
For producing balanced forces, the said vertical distance that sockets reinforcing bar adjacent on the vertical direction is reduced successively, from top to bottom as being followed successively by 670mm, 450mm, 300mm from top to bottom.
Preferably, the said wall back of the body is vertical, and metope is tiltedly faced upward, and said barricade body has the overhanging bottom platform of both direction level forwards, backwards, is chamfered transition between the said wall back of the body and bottom platform.Said bottom platform can effectively reduce basic stress and increase stability against overturning.
Because the utility model is mainly used in the revetment protection of Bin Shui; Consideration from the ecological exchange and the ecological homeostasis; Said concrete is preferably eco-concrete, and this kind concrete is except can playing high-strength bank protection effect, also because himself porosity and high ventilation water permeability; Really play purifying water, the effect of the protection ecosystem.
Can be between the adjacent said steel form through connecting reinforcement 2 connections and fixing.The diameter of used connecting reinforcement is selected for use according to the actual loading situation.In the present embodiment; The diameter that connects the said connecting reinforcement of the said wall back of the body, metope place steel form is preferably the reinforcing bar that diameter is 18mm, should be greater than the diameter (the preferred employing directly is the reinforcing bar of 12mm) of the said connecting reinforcement that connects wall top and said bottom platform place steel form.
In order further to improve the intensity of barricade, can also be fixed with some gauze wire cloths in the said barricade, gauze wire cloth with said socket reinforcing bar and concrete be consolidated into as a whole, said gauze wire cloth and socket the steel frame that reinforcing bar becomes said barricade.
When carrying out the construction of the utility model; Elder generation's excavation slope and the smooth Bin Shui ground that goes out to pre-set said barricade, formwork are built and are built said barricade, treat to remove steel form after the hardening of concrete; Carry on the back a side backfill to wall then, the said wall back of the body is fitted tightly with slight slope.
